... in USA without requiring sponsorship Position: Sr Product Manager (Job id ...
a month ago
... in USA without requiring sponsorship Position: Project Manager Scrum Master (Job ... % ONSITE) Duration: 6 Months + Possible Extension Position S
6 days ago